In the most drastic step the NBA has made to counter load management, teams can now be fined for resting healthy players. BetOnline has released prop bet odds, with the Clippers favored to be the first and most fined team for resting healthy players.The LA Clippers’ Kawhi Leonard and Paul George have become the poster boys of the NBA for load management.On Wednesday, the NBA Board of Governors approved a “Player Participation Policy” to reduce teams from frequently resting healthy players.
